Huawei Honor Note 10 full specs outed by TENAA

Posted by Payton Wilmott On Monday, July 23, 2018 0 comments

Huawei subsidiary Honor is preparing the Note 10 for a launch next Tuesday. Some of the specs like a tall AMOLED display and Kirin 970 chipset were already leaked, but the full list was just listed on the Chinese regulatory website TENAA. The new phablet will be available with plenty of RAM and storage options. It will also have a 16 MP + 24 MP camera setup, likely the same as the smaller sibling Honor 10 where the secondary sensor is monochrome.
